Transaction d6812568cae63d374a7cbb94606cc139fa08fc9755a9a52c40105308e9681cc3
1 Input
1 Output
-
d6812568cae63d374a7cbb94606cc139fa08fc9755a9a52c40105308e9681cc3:0
- value
- 576683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1a2b5521f723ee4d79ff042188b15064fa150cb OP_EQUAL
- address
- 3NG4ssj4Fo6puvWfe8eMV2CS6STRLLhFLK